Doorbraak VS: “Het begin van het einde is begonnen”

Een historische doorbraak in de VS: gisteren stemden de staten Colorado en Washington voor legalisering van cannabis. Inwoners van deze staten van 21 jaar en ouder mogen voortaan tot een ounce (28 gram) cannabis kopen en bezitten en zes planten thuis hebben. In een reactie schrijft NORML voorzitter Allen St. Pierre: “The beginning of the end has begun.”

“R.I.P. American Drug War?” is de kop van het artikel waarin Allen St. Pierre, executive director van NORML (National Organization for the Reform of Marijuana Laws), reageert op het verheugende nieuws.

R.I.P American Drug War?

The beginning of the end…has begun.

Yesterday’s elections have forever changed the playing field regarding cannabis prohibition laws in America (and probably in large parts of the world too).re-legalize2012

The citizens of Colorado, Washington and Massachusetts delivered game changing victories last night for the nearly fifty year-old cannabis law reform Movement. Massachusetts becomes the eighteenth state to pass legal protections for qualified medical patients who’ve cannabis recommended to them by a physician. Colorado and Washington become the first places in the world, ever, where citizens have cast votes to reject cannabis prohibition, and replace the failed public policy with alternatives like tax-n-regulate models (similar to the control and taxation models widely accepted for alcohol and tobacco product use by adults).

NORML’s board of directors, staff, chapter network and members congratulate the state-based organizers who planned and worked hard to qualify and pass these important voter initiatives, and we thank the voters of these states for helping to propel the nation to the eventual—if not soon coming—end to cannabis prohibition.10577021_h18117668

Will there continue to be fits and starts, federal government incursion into state sovereignty and obstinate politicians?

Surely.

However, the die for major cannabis law reforms is now cast.

NORML will continue to be the central hub of information about all things cannabis and yesterday’s victories insure that 2013 is going to be another landmark year for needed cannabis law reforms.
